Board accepts donations to athletics, arts and classroom programs

Summary

The board read and approved a slate of donations — including gifts to elementary schools, Austin High athletics, choir, and technical programs — in accordance with board policy 706. The board voted to accept the donations at the meeting.

Tom Lambert, executive director of finance and operations, read a list of recent donations to the district, including: $2,050 from Hormel to elementary programs; $600 to Austin High School student counseling; $2,000 to boys hockey from Austin Eagles; a welding machine and mask for the welding program donated by Mississippi Welder Supply; and other gifts to choir, athletics and scholarship funds.

A board member moved to approve acceptance of the donations and the motion passed. The presenter said the donations comply with district policy 706 and asked the board to accept them into district accounts so staff can allocate funds and assets to the indicated programs.

No additional financial details or restrictions attached to the donations were discussed at the meeting; donors and designated recipients were read aloud during the presentation.
